Locked Out Of Heaven
Locked Out Of Heaven stands as a defining track from Bruno Mars's 2012 album, Unorthodox Jukebox. The recording showcases the artist's signature blend of rock, reggae, and soul influences, marking a distinct shift in his musical direction. Produced during a period of significant commercial success, the song highlights Mars's ability to craft infectious pop anthems with retro sensibilities. Its energetic rhythm and dynamic vocal performance solidified its place within his broader discography, appealing to a wide audience through its polished production and timeless appeal. The track remains a staple in his live performances, reflecting the high-energy style that characterizes much of his work from this era. |
